Railroad Collision.—A serious collision ami
Bnuali op of cam, occurred on Monday aight
Soul 10 o'clock, on thsPennsylesnm Byroad,
:«ar Hillside Station. The apoomffiodation train,
-which leaseaPittsburgh atlalf-pastflee oclocb,
to the afternoon, was run lntoby a
and three e»r» smashed to pieces. TI J*
at Um time of the accident, was standing per
feetlr still, haring been detained by some de-
Sment to the tmehinery of the locomotire.
aware that a freight ta»fa was
ooming np a short distanoe behind, sent back
the baggage master, with a
to Stop; bnl the engineer not pbsefting the
light, the train earns dashing along with unaba
ted speed, and crashed through the aoeommoda
tion. the roar esr was literaUy split fa two,
and two other eers badly smashed. PorWnately
there were bat three passengers fa the bac>c»r,
and.these obSerred the freight '"fa “T"*
time to jump out before she strnek. .Bsesral
hasseneerß, in the other ears, also attempted to
' geton* bat in tbeirpertarbatlon
seed in opening the door. None of them, ho
erer, were fajmted.- Seterdof tboMghtc.»,
and tho locomotire were badly smashed.

The Sivtr remained stationary iw pad twenty-tout
hoar*, *HI» nineteen inohee *T b ™
there will bemore w&en tfce rise of Monday tfow
downfrom jßrownsvUlfi %
. By a private despatch £nsa Brownsville, we loom that the
river had needed «va tnehea during Monday night, at that
; point, And fas itUl fettitig. .
Two new steeme» arrived from .BroirnaviUe yesterday
tho Cbnooanga, OapL M.Oot, and the Swallow, Oapt. Wm
(lormley. !They are toe boats.
Wt dip tho following from the iymlsTUla Courier ol the
14th Inst:: ' wl .
“ The river was materially aflboted yesterday by tho late
indie. '
upwards of two feet water In *a «sml JJt
patches fren Frankfort were rweived yesbaday, whkhßta
tod that heavy rains had fallen in that ntfta, Ken
i tuokv river had risen five feet, and was still rising. au*
j river wme twenty-two mStas below ben, was rising yester
day fromthe effeota of the tain, and a fine stage of water is
I anUdpated.*V_
